New book Mariette Vermeylen-Nuyts Katie's dream As the mother of a child born with a facial disfigurement, for years Mariette Vermeylen desperately searched for an explanation and insight into her family’s plight. She studied stacks of medical literature. During her quest, she came to realize that not only parents, but also afflicted children themselves have a need for information and recognition. She could not fine one children’s book in Belgium that addressed this problem, so she decided to write one herself.“Katie’s Dream” is a story of hope and optimism. A story of acceptance of the things in life that are not possible, and the triumph in discovering what can be achieved. A story for all children with a different face, as well as their families, friends, classmates and teachers. Mariette Vermeylen-Nuyts is the Chair of the Belgian Association for Congenital Facial Defects, VAGA vzw. This self-help group, established in 1992, has been granted the Patronage of Her Royal Highness Princess Mathilde of Belgium for its outstanding achievements.
